In our dataset, we didn't detect a clear dose–outcome relationship. This really is in settlement Together with the trial described by Steels and colleagues where PEA afforded a substantial reduction in suffering with none important difference between clients randomized to either three hundred mg/day or 600 mg/working day doses [26].

In 2017, Artukoglu and colleagues posted the first meta-Examination around the efficacy of PEA for soreness therapy [16]. Their report was complete because of the benchmarks of the out there literature, plus they ended up in a position to draw the summary that PEA was of possible utility being an analgesic. However, a detailed analysis was impeded by remarkably heterogeneous randomized managed trials with important methodological restrictions and relatively minimal high quality, as assessed through the authors.

Inside the 1960s, PEA was initial marketed for prophylactic therapy of influenza plus the prevalent chilly. Analysis curiosity amplified during the seventies, with six clinical trials confirming the effectiveness of PEA on influenza signs or symptoms and incidence.

The antiallergic outcomes of What is PEA PEA may be traced back towards the fifties, when Coburn and colleagues described that a phospholipid fraction isolated from egg yolk shown antiallergic activity in guinea pigs [45].
